ASMPT  (OTCPK:ASMVY) 3-Year RORE % Explanation

Return on Retained Earnings (RORE) is important to investors because it reveals a company's efficiency and growth potential. A higher RORE indicates a higher return. A high RORE indicates that the company should reinvest profits into the business. A lower RORE suggests that the company should distribute profits to shareholders by paying out dividends, since those dollars aren't generating much additional growth for the company.

There are a several different ways to arrive at the Return on Retained Earnings. The simplest way to calculate it is by using published information on Earnings per Share (EPS) and Dividend per Share (DPS) over a selected period. Here, 3-year period is chosen.

Be Aware

Please keep in mind that the RORE is relative to the nature of the business and its competitors. If another company in the same sector is producing a lower return on retained earnings, it doesn’t necessarily mean it’s a bad investment. It may just suggest the company is older and no longer in a high growth stage. At such a stage in the business cycle, it would be expected to see a lower RORE and higher dividend payout.

ASMPT Business Description

Address 2 Yishun Avenue 7, Singapore, SGP, 768924
ASMPT designs, manufactures, and sells precision equipment used to assemble semiconductors and other electronic equipment. Listed on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ange since 1989, ASMPT is headquartered in Hong Kong and has operations in Asia, Europe, and the US. It is the largest supplier globally in both the assembly and packaging equipment market and the surface mounted technology market. Recent growth has been driven by the growing use of advanced packaging in high end memory and logic semiconductors.
